On November 16, 2021, Immigration, Refugees and Citizenship Canada (IRCC) will update the National Occupation Classification (NOC) to include the Training, Education, Experience, and Responsibilities (TEER) system.
The NOC is revised every ten years to keep up with the changing Canadian labour market.
This newest revision provides a new framework for classifying occupations by Employment and Social Development Canada (ESDC) and Statistics Canada.
The only impact this change will have, is administrative, as there will be no changes to advertising or delivery of the immigration programs.
